Re: Suggestion For A Good Belt Craftsman
Scotweb do a plain one with the buckle type you are after:
http://www.scotweb.co.uk/products/gr...square-buckle/
Although there is nothing on their website I bought a sporran from http://www.leathersporrans.co.uk/ and they made me a belt (with a buckle as opposed to a plate) to go with it. I believe they make everything to order and by the look of their tooled sporrans (mine was plain) they certainly have the ability to make something to your specifications. It might be worth dropping them an email to see if they can help. I was extremely pleased with both my belt and sporran. A small bonus is that the price was very keen.
